14 Jul 128 Ind 1957 19 February 1958 RE: Deming-Columbus-Las Cruces UFO Case 714 July 1957 Investigative efforts in subject case reveal that source, Collete Weiss, was not reliable. Following her receipt of investigative forms which my organization sent out, we received a diary of her UFO sightings covering a considerable period. Telephone conversation with 685th ACWRON at Las Cruces revealed the results of their investigation with the source. They stated that, in their opinion, there would be nothing gained by a full AISS investigation due to the obvious unreliability of the source. The …
